Stone Driveway Construction in Longmont, CO
Stone driveway construction involves the installation of durable, attractive surfaces made from natural or manufactured stone materials. This service covers a variety of projects, including creating new driveways, expanding existing ones, or replacing old surfaces with a more resilient and visually appealing option. Property owners typically want to understand the different types of stone available, such as flagstone, cobblestone, or crushed stone, as well as the benefits of choosing stone for longevity and curb appeal. Additionally, questions about the preparation process, maintenance requirements, and how the finished driveway will complement the property's overall look are common before requesting this service.
Homeowners often seek stone driveway construction to improve their property's functionality and aesthetic value. Before requesting a project, it’s helpful to consider the size and layout of the driveway, the type of stone that best suits the property's style, and any drainage or foundation needs. Understanding the scope of work, including excavation, base preparation, and finishing details, can ensure the project aligns with expectations. Clear communication about these aspects can help property owners make informed decisions and achieve a durable, attractive driveway that enhances the property's exterior.

Stone Driveway Construction Questions
What are common materials used for stone driveways? Common options include flagstone, granite, and limestone, each offering durability and aesthetic appeal for driveway surfaces.
How long does a stone driveway typically last? With proper installation and maintenance, stone driveways can last several decades, making them a long-term landscaping choice.
Are stone driveways suitable for all types of properties? Stone driveways work well on various property types, especially where a natural, durable surface complements the landscape.
What should property owners consider before installing a stone driveway? Factors include existing terrain, drainage needs, and the desired style to ensure the driveway fits the property's layout and aesthetic.
